[Jeju=Asia Economy Honam Reporting Headquarters Reporter Hwang Jeongpil] The Jeju Fire Safety Headquarters (Chief Park Geun-oh) has issued a safety accident warning for haenyeo (female divers) during their work, urging special caution as accidents related to haenyeo, including cardiac arrest, have been steadily occurring recently.
According to the Jeju Fire Safety Headquarters on the 8th, there have been a total of 46 safety accidents involving Jeju haenyeo over the past three years. Cardiac arrest incidents accounted for the highest number with 21 cases (45.7%), followed by dizziness and vertigo with 6 cases (13%), and breathing difficulties with 5 cases (10.9%).
By age group, 27 cases (58.7%) involved those in their 70s, 13 cases (28.3%) in their 80s, and 3 cases (6.5%) in their 60s, showing a high accident rate of 87% among those aged 70 and above.
On the 11th of last month, a haenyeo in her 70s working in the waters off Sinchang-ri, Hangyeong-myeon, died of cardiac arrest, highlighting the need for increased safety precautions as the majority of haenyeo are aged 70 or older.
The Jeju Fire Safety Headquarters plans to issue an early safety accident warning during the first half of the year, when the work periods for conch and the harvesting period for Eucheuma (cheoncho) from April to June overlap, as accidents tend to concentrate during this time. They also intend to strengthen cooperation with related organizations and enhance response readiness, including dispatch preparedness.
They will promote the importance of initial emergency treatment before the arrival of the 119 ambulance team and plan to conduct on-site emergency treatment training to improve fishermen’s CPR skills in collaboration with volunteer fire brigade professional instructors.
A representative from the Jeju Fire Safety Headquarters said, “Diving operations must always be done with a partner to ensure each other’s safety,” and urged, “Please follow safety rules during diving operations, such as wearing safety gear and doing warm-up exercises.”
